poorlittle
第11楼2010/05/20
欢迎讨论。 为了活跃气氛, 我以相声演员“逗哏”的形式回应, 不要见怪:
第一、 作为客户, 我有权在乎。
况且, 我这钱是准备捐给災区人民的, 0.31亿也好, 3角钱也好, 都不应侵吞嘛!
第二、汇率后面不可能还跟有无数个数字
汇率是我在网上查的, 一般4至6位。
即使汇率是6.86213,有6位效数字, 若我拿100005美元兑换人民币, 100005 × 6.86213 = 686247.3元。银行说两个6位有效数字相乘之积, 其有效位数为6位, 所以也只给我686247元, 即侵吞了我0.3元。 不为3角钱, 是为了讨个公道。
关键问题 : 银行根据有效数字规则办事有错吗?
Alann
第20楼2010/11/16
个人觉得,理论上,只要减少了有效数字的位数,那么就一定会存在误差。
如果计算1美元,汇率小数点后保留两位有效数字(之后按照四舍五入截去),那么1美元在换算中可能产生的误差最大不超过0.5分;
类似的,1美元,汇率小数点后保留三位有效数字时,产生最大误差不超过0.05分。
当你有1美元去银行兑换,这个过程将因计算中使用的汇率的有效数字的位数产生误差,这个误差也就是金钱。
假设汇率按小数点后保留两位,在“四舍”的过程中,银行每1元最多可能少付给你0.5分,但如果是“五入”,银行将最多会多付给你0.5分。
使用的有效数字位数越多,肯定这个误差就越小。但不要小看这个小小的误差,就整个银行的业务来讲,每天就给他按100亿的兑换业务来算,不用给出具体数字,我们也都能感觉到那是一笔大数字。
所以,实际操作中,汇率小数点后按多少位有效数字以及如果存在截短情况采用何种截短方式都会产生巨大的影响,银行肯定有自己具体的规定,我就无从知晓了。
但我认为较合理的方式是计算时采用官方公布的汇率数字的全部有效位数,在最终结果中精确到分。这个过程中不存在银行主观上的对数字的位数的减少,也就无从认为此过程中存在误差了,最多是最终结果中的不超过0.5分的误差。
不仅仅是汇率,利息也是一样。好像电影中有利用特殊软件,将银行所有客户因为利息计算过程中舍去的金额汇集起来,最终成为一笔巨款的故事。